Metabolic Pathways It is the pathway to show to generate energy and remove metabolite

Metabolic Pathways It is the pathway to show to generate energy and remove metabolite for a body. Signal Transduction Pathways It is the pathway to show to control the behaviors of a cell in terms of time and location with the signals like hormones. Regulatory Pathways (Gene Regulatory Network) It is the pathway to show to adapt to the change of environment based on the principles encoded in hereditary materials (e. g. DNA). 12/20/2021 Taiwan International Graduate Program Academia Sinica 4

To understand the mechanism of organism • It provides the guidance for biologists to design experiments. • It helps pharmacist to design drugs easier. • It makes us know the difference of mechanism between species. Enable us to do the simulation • It saves time and money for biologists to do experiments. • It predicts the behaviors by a special treatment for an organism. • It waives the dangers to try a new drug on patients. 12/20/2021 Taiwan International Graduate Program Academia Sinica 6
